The conversion of glycerol as a renewable feedstock into value- added chemicals is of great significance from a viewpoint of the sustainable development. In this work, a series of Ni promoted noble metal catalysts including PtmNinOx/TiO2, Pd1Ni1Ox/TiO2 with various metal compositions were prepared for glycerol oxidation in aqueous solution in the presence of NaOH. It was found that Ni significantly improved the activity of the noble metals to catalyze glycerol conversion, and lactic acid (LA) was the predominant product. The influence of the metal composition on the glycerol conversion and LA yield was investigated, and it was demonstrated that Pt1Ni1Ox/TiO2 displayed the best performance, giving a LA selectivity of 62.6% at the glycerol conversion of 99.1%.
